North Texas Giving Day Faces Increased Demand Amidst Funding Challenges

Dated: September 10, 2025

North Texas Giving Day, the nation’s largest regional philanthropic event, is underway with an unprecedented number of participating charities. This year, over 3,600 local nonprofits are seeking support, a significant increase driven by widespread funding cuts impacting more than half of these organizations. The event aims to bridge the gap created by these financial challenges, enabling vital community services to continue.

Key Takeaways

  • More than 3,600 North Texas charities are participating in this year’s North Texas Giving Day.
  • Over half of the participating nonprofits are experiencing greater financial struggles than in previous years.
  • Funding cuts have significantly impacted the operational capacity of many local organizations.
  • North Texas Giving Day is crucial for sustaining the essential work of these charities.

The Growing Need for Support

Rebecca Babin, Senior Director of North Texas Giving Day, highlighted the "overwhelming" response from charities this year, noting that the need is greater than it has been in many years. A survey conducted by the Communities Foundation of Texas, the organization behind North Texas Giving Day, revealed that a substantial number of nonprofits have faced significant funding losses. This situation underscores the critical importance of community donations to ensure these organizations can maintain their services.

Hugs Cafe: A Story of Inclusion and Purpose

Hugs Cafe in McKinney exemplifies the impact of these nonprofits. This social enterprise provides employment and training for adults with developmental and intellectual disabilities. Executive Director Lauren Smith described the atmosphere as "beautiful," where every employee finds purpose. Employee Ben Jennings shared his positive experience, stating, "When you work here, you feel like family." The cafe relies heavily on donations from North Texas Giving Day to support its mission and plans to expand to Dallas, which would double the number of individuals it serves.

The Significance of North Texas Giving Day

As the largest regional philanthropic event in the country, North Texas Giving Day provides a vital platform for charities to connect with donors. The donation window is currently open, with the official event day being Thursday, September 18. The increased participation and the documented financial strain on local charities emphasize the critical role this event plays in bolstering community well-being and supporting those who are often underserved.
